After flying high against St. Joseph Catholic last Friday, Presbyterian Christian came back down to earth. The Presbyterian Christian Bobcats were beaten by the Jackson Academy Raiders 38-0 on Friday. The shutout was out of character for the Bobcats seeing as the last time the team failed to score was back in September.
Omarean Ellis contin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ines for Jackson Academy, rushing for 175 yards and two touchdowns while picking up 8.8 yards per carry. Pruet James was another key player, throwing for 182 yards and two touchdowns on only 16 passes.
Presbyterian Christian's loss dropped their record down to 5-4. As for Jackson Academy, their victory bumped their record up to 8-2.
Presbyterian Christian has already played their next contest, a 49-17 defeat against Madison-Ridgeland Academy on the 1st. As for Jackson Academy, they also wasted no time getting back out on the field and have already played their next game, a 28-17 loss against Hartfield Academy on the 1st.
